White aubergines, depending on the variety, can reach various sizes. Based on information about a specific heirloom variety known for its suitability for the UK climate, these aubergines typically grow to approximately 7 inches (18 cm) long.
Understanding White Aubergine Size
The size of white aubergines can vary by type. The provided information describes a particular heirloom variety that matures early, making it well-suited for regions with shorter summers like the UK.
Key Size Characteristics of This Specific Variety:
- Length: Approximately 7 inches (18 cm)
- Shape: Teardrop
- Skin: Thin
- Texture: Firm
These characteristics not only define their typical size but also contribute to their mild flavor and firm texture, making them a popular choice for cooking.
Factors Influencing Size
While a specific variety has a general size range, factors such as growing conditions, soil quality, watering, and sunlight can influence the final size of the fruit. However, for the heirloom type mentioned, reaching around 7 inches is considered a standard size at maturity.
This size is practical for culinary uses, being easy to handle and cook.
